Warning Signs You Need Ceiling Drywall Water Damage Restoration
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ars and prevent bigger problems down the line. Don't ignore these warning signs! Here are some common indicators that you may need ceiling drywall water damage restoration:
Musty Odors That Won't Go Away
Unpleasant odors can be a sign of water damage or mold growth. Don't ignore these odors! If you notice a persistent musty smell in your property, it's essential to investigate the source and address it quickly.
Water Stains on the Ceiling
Water stains can be a sign of a leak or water damage. Don't delay! If you notice water stains on your ceiling, it's ess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or high humidity. Don't ignore these signs! If you notice peeling paint or wallpaper, it's essential to investigate the cause and address it quickly.
Warped or Buckled Drywall
Warped or buckled drywall can be a sign of water damage or high humidity. Don't delay! If you notice warped or buckled drywall, it's ess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Unexplained Mold Growth
Mold growth can be a sign of water damage or high humidity. Don't ignore these signs! If you notice unexplained mold growth in your property, it's essential to investigate the cause and address it quickly.
Ceiling Drywall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ak in a single room | Yes | No | You can fix the leak and replace the drywall yourself. |
| Large leak in multiple rooms | No | Yes | A large leak needs specialized equipment and expertise to fix. |
| Water damage with mold growth | No | Yes | Mold growth needs specialized equipment and expertise to remove safely. |
| High humidity or condensation issues | No | Yes | High humidity or condensation issues need specialized equipment and expertise to fix. |
| Insurance claim or warranty issue | No | Yes | A professional restoration company can help navigate the insurance claim or warranty process. |

Ceiling Drywall Water Damage Restoration Cost in Hawthorne, NJ
The cost of ceiling drywall water damage restoration can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Hawthorne, NJ. Get a free estimate today! Our team will work with you to develop a customized solution that meets your specific needs and budget.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Damage Assessment and Planning | $500 - $2,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ions. |
| Water Removal and Drying | $1,000 - $5,000 | Amount of water, size of affected area, and equipment needed. |
| Drywall Removal and Replacement | $2,000 - $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of drywall, and labor required. |
| Painting and Finishing | $1,000 - $3,000 | Size of affected area, type of paint, and labor required. |
| Mold Remediation | $2,000 - $10,000 | Severity of mold growth, size of affected area, and equipment needed. |
